#074ffe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#074ffe is composed of 2.7% red, 31%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 222.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#074ffe color hex could be obtained by blending #0e9eff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#074ffe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000206 is the darkest color, while #f1f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#074ffe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7f8b is the less saturated color, while #074ffe is the most saturated one.
